Well-placed in the business area of Ulaanbaatar city, Park Hotel provides a most conducive spot for you to take a break from your busy days. Set 2 Km from the excitement of the city, this 4-star hotel commands ... Read more

View all Luxury Hotels in Ulaanbaatar